#pragma semicolon 1;
#include <sourcemod>
#include <sdktools>
#include <left4dhooks>
#include <colors>
#include <readyup>
#include <l4d_tank_control_eq>
#include "includes/finalemaps"
#pragma newdecls required
#define IS_VALID_CLIENT(%1) (%1 > 0 && %1 <= MaxClients)
#define IS_INFECTED(%1) (GetClientTeam(%1) == 3)
#define IS_VALID_INGAME(%1) (IS_VALID_CLIENT(%1) && IsClientInGame(%1))
#define IS_VALID_INFECTED(%1) (IS_VALID_INGAME(%1) && IS_INFECTED(%1))
#define MAXSTEAMID 64
#define MAXMAP 64
#define MAXTANKS 4
Handle g_hCvarDebug = INVALID_HANDLE;
StringMap g_hStaticTankPlayers[MAXTANKS];
char g_sQueuedTankSteamId[MAXSTEAMID] = "";
int g_iTankCount = 0;
bool g_bRoundStarted = false;
enum strMapType {
MP_FINALE
};
public Plugin myinfo = {
name = "Static Tank Control",
author = "devilesk",
description = "Predetermined tank control distribution.",
version = "0.7.0",
url = "https://github.com/devilesk/rl4d2l-plugins"
}
public void OnPluginStart() {
for ( int i = 0; i < MAXTANKS; i++ ) {
g_hStaticTankPlayers[i] = new StringMap();
}
HookEvent("round_start", RoundStart_Event, EventHookMode_PostNoCopy);
HookEvent("round_end", RoundEnd_Event, EventHookMode_PostNoCopy);
HookEvent("player_team", PlayerTeam_Event, EventHookMode_PostNoCopy);
RegServerCmd("static_tank_control", StaticTankControl_Command);
RegServerCmd("static_tank_control_tank_num", StaticTankControlTankNum_Command);
g_hCvarDebug = CreateConVar("static_tank_control_debug", "0", "Whether or not to debug to console", 0);
}
/**
* Provides a way to set the tank count in case plugin is reloaded after a tank has spawned.
*/
public Action StaticTankControlTankNum_Command(int args) {
if (args < 1) {
LogError("[StaticTankControlTankNum_Command] Missing args");
return Plugin_Handled;
}
char sTankNum[16];
GetCmdArg(1, sTankNum, sizeof(sTankNum));
int iTankNum = StringToInt(sTankNum);
if (iTankNum < 1 || iTankNum > MAXTANKS) {
LogError("[StaticTankControlTankNum_Command] Invalid tank num arg");
return Plugin_Handled;
}
g_iTankCount = iTankNum - 1;
PrintDebug("[StaticTankControlTankNum_Command] iTankNum: %i, g_iTankCount: %i", iTankNum, g_iTankCount);
return Plugin_Handled;
}
public Action StaticTankControl_Command(int args) {
if (args < 2) {
LogError("[StaticTankControl_Command] Missing args");
return Plugin_Handled;
}
char sTankNum[16];
GetCmdArg(1, sTankNum, sizeof(sTankNum));
int iTankNum = StringToInt(sTankNum);
if (iTankNum < 1 || iTankNum > MAXTANKS) {
LogError("[StaticTankControl_Command] Invalid tank num arg");
return Plugin_Handled;
}
char sMapName[MAXMAP];
GetCmdArg(2, sMapName, sizeof(sMapName));
StrToLower(sMapName);
ArrayList hSteamIds = new ArrayList(MAXSTEAMID);
g_hStaticTankPlayers[iTankNum-1].SetValue(sMapName, hSteamIds);
char steamId[MAXSTEAMID];
for ( int i = 3; i <= args; i++ ) {
GetCmdArg(i, steamId, sizeof(steamId));
if (strlen(steamId)) {
hSteamIds.PushString(steamId);
PrintDebug("[StaticTankControl_Command] Added iTankNum: %i, sMapName: %s steamId: %s", iTankNum, sMapName, steamId);
}
}
return Plugin_Handled;
}
/**
* When a new game starts, reset the tank pool.
*/
public void TankControlEQ_OnTankControlReset() {
PrintDebug("[TankControlEQ_OnTankControlReset] Resetting tank control.");
g_sQueuedTankSteamId[0] = '\0';
g_iTankCount = 0;
}
public void RoundStart_Event(Handle event, const char[] name, bool dontBroadcast) {
g_bRoundStarted = true;
g_iTankCount = 0;
g_sQueuedTankSteamId[0] = '\0';
}
public void RoundEnd_Event(Handle event, const char[] name, bool dontBroadcast) {
g_bRoundStarted = false;
}
/**
* When a player reconnects, check if they are the static tank player
*/
public void OnClientConnected(int client) {
if (!g_bRoundStarted) return;
char steamId[MAXSTEAMID];
if (IS_VALID_INFECTED(client)) {
GetClientAuthId(client, AuthId_Steam2, steamId, sizeof(steamId));
if (StrEqual(g_sQueuedTankSteamId, steamId)) {
PrintDebug("[OnClientConnected] Static tank player reconnected. Setting player as tank. steamId: %s.", steamId);
TankControlEQ_SetTank(steamId);
}
}
}
/**
* When the queued tank switches to infected, check if they are the static tank player
*/
public void PlayerTeam_Event(Handle event, const char[] name, bool dontBroadcast) {
if (!g_bRoundStarted) return;
char steamId[MAXSTEAMID];
int client = GetClientOfUserId(GetEventInt(event, "userid"));
if (IS_VALID_INFECTED(client)) {
GetClientAuthId(client, AuthId_Steam2, steamId, sizeof(steamId));
if (StrEqual(g_sQueuedTankSteamId, steamId)) {
PrintDebug("[OnClientConnected] Static tank player joined infected. Setting player as tank. steamId: %s.", steamId);
TankControlEQ_SetTank(steamId);
}
}
}
public Action TankControlEQ_OnChooseTank() {
if (g_iTankCount >= MAXTANKS) {
PrintDebug("[TankControlEQ_OnChooseTank] g_iTankCount: %i tanks spawned >= MAXTANKS %i. Continuing with default tank selection.", g_iTankCount, MAXTANKS);
return Plugin_Continue;
}
ArrayList hStaticTankPlayers;
char sMapName[MAXMAP];
GetCurrentMapLower(sMapName, sizeof(sMapName));
PrintDebug("[TankControlEQ_OnChooseTank] Attempting to find static tank player for map %s tank %i.", sMapName, g_iTankCount + 1);
// check that there is a static tank list for the current tank spawn on this map
if (!g_hStaticTankPlayers[g_iTankCount].GetValue(sMapName, hStaticTankPlayers)) {
PrintDebug("[TankControlEQ_OnChooseTank] Map %s for tank %i not found. Continuing with default tank selection.", sMapName, g_iTankCount + 1);
return Plugin_Continue;
}
// check static tank list not empty
int iStaticTankPlayersSize = hStaticTankPlayers.Length;
if (!iStaticTankPlayersSize) {
PrintDebug("[TankControlEQ_OnChooseTank] Static tank players size: %i. Continuing with default tank selection.", iStaticTankPlayersSize);
return Plugin_Continue;
}
// if finale and someone has not played tank, then use default tank selection
ArrayList hWhosNotHadTank = TankControlEQ_GetWhosNotHadTank();
int iWhosNotHadTankSize = hWhosNotHadTank.Length;
if (IsMissionFinalMap() && iWhosNotHadTankSize > 0) {
PrintDebug("[TankControlEQ_OnChooseTank] Finale with %i skipped tank player. Continuing with default tank selection.", iWhosNotHadTankSize);
delete hWhosNotHadTank;
return Plugin_Continue;
}
delete hWhosNotHadTank;
// find a static tank player in the pool of tank players
ArrayList hTankPool = TankControlEQ_GetTankPool();
char sSteamId[MAXSTEAMID];
if (FindSteamIdInArrays(sSteamId, sizeof(sSteamId), hTankPool, hStaticTankPlayers)) {
strcopy(g_sQueuedTankSteamId, sizeof(g_sQueuedTankSteamId), sSteamId); // store static tank player in case they disconnect or change teams
PrintDebug("[TankControlEQ_OnChooseTank] Setting tank to %s.", sSteamId);
TankControlEQ_SetTank(sSteamId);
delete hTankPool;
return Plugin_Handled;
}
PrintDebug("[TankControlEQ_OnChooseTank] No static tank player in tank pool. Continuing with default tank selection.");
delete hTankPool;
return Plugin_Continue;
}
public bool FindSteamIdInArrays(char[] buffer, int bufferLen, ArrayList hArrayA, ArrayList hArrayB) {
char sSteamIdA[MAXSTEAMID];
char sSteamIdB[MAXSTEAMID];
for (int i = 0; i < hArrayA.Length; i++) {
hArrayA.GetString(i, sSteamIdA, sizeof(sSteamIdA));
for (int j = 0; j < hArrayB.Length; j++) {
hArrayB.GetString(j, sSteamIdB, sizeof(sSteamIdB));
if (StrEqual(sSteamIdA, sSteamIdB)) {
strcopy(buffer, bufferLen, sSteamIdA);
PrintDebug("[FindSteamIdInArrays] Match found. steamId: %s. buffer: %s", sSteamIdA, buffer);
return true;
}
}
}
PrintDebug("[FindSteamIdInArrays] Match not found.");
return false;
}
public void TankControlEQ_OnTankGiven(const char[] steamId) {
// stop storing static tank player once they've been given tank
if (StrEqual(g_sQueuedTankSteamId, steamId))
g_sQueuedTankSteamId[0] = '\0';
g_iTankCount++;
PrintDebug("[TankControlEQ_OnTankGiven] Gave tank %i to %s.", g_iTankCount, steamId);
}
/**
* Retrieves a valid infected player's client index by their steam id.
*
* @param const String:steamId[]
* The steam id to look for.
*
* @return
* The player's client index.
*/
public int GetValidInfectedClientBySteamId(const char[] steamId) {
char tmpSteamId[MAXSTEAMID];
for (int i = 1; i <= MaxClients; i++) {
if (!IS_VALID_INFECTED(i))
continue;
GetClientAuthId(i, AuthId_Steam2, tmpSteamId, sizeof(tmpSteamId));
if (StrEqual(steamId, tmpSteamId))
return i;
}
return -1;
}
stock void PrintDebug(const char[] Message, any ...) {
if (GetConVarBool(g_hCvarDebug)) {
char DebugBuff[256];
VFormat(DebugBuff, sizeof(DebugBuff), Message, 2);
LogMessage(DebugBuff);
for (int x = 1; x <= MaxClients; x++) {
if (IsClientInGame(x)) {
SetGlobalTransTarget(x);
PrintToConsole(x, DebugBuff);
}
}
}
}
